India Post and World Trade Centre Sign MoU to Empower MSMEs and Entrepreneurs!

In a landmark step towards strengthening India’s international trade ecosystem, India Posht and the World Trade Centre (WTC), Mumbai have signed a historic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) today in Mumbai to enhance global market access for Indian businesses, with a special focus on MSMEs and entrepreneurs. This strategic collaboration combines India Post ’s unmatched postal reach with WTC’s global trade expertise, thus creating a powerful platform to help Indian enterprises expand their footprint in international markets. The novel initiative is expected to boost exports , facilitate cross-border partnerships, and empower small businesses to go global. The MoU was signed in the presence of Suchita Joshi , Postmaster General, Navi Mumbai Region , Dr. Sudhir G. Jhakere , Assistant Postmaster General and Dr. Vijay Kalantri , Chairman, WTC Mumbai.
